The accommodation comprises; private entrance on the ground floor into an entrance hall and stairs up to a spacious landing. There is a large 15’2 x 14’6 reception room and a good size separate modern kitchen. The master bedroom is a very generous 14’8 x 12’5 with built in wardrobes, a second double bedroom and a modern bathroom with separate shower and bath. The property further benefits from a large rear communal garden (shared with only one other) and a communal front garden.
This is a fantastic apartment and is sold chain free.
Beaconsfield Road is a very popular road within the Westcombe Park area in Blackheath. Westcombe Park Station is just 200 metres away, (regular trains into Central London in 17 minutes, with the DLR within easy reach from Greenwich).
The property is within 850 metres from both the heath and Greenwich Park. An outstanding location to take advantage of local amenities in almost all directions. Walking south 1.1 miles, you will arrive in Blackheath village which offers an array of boutique shops, bars and restaurants giving a genuine feeling of village life inside London. 0.6 miles to the west you will find the historic Greenwich town centre. Finally, 0.45 miles to the southeast is Blackheath Standard, with daily conveniences including M&S Food Hall.
A short walk away are sought after primary schools including Sherington, Invicta and Halstow. There are many independent schools including Blackheath Preparatory School, The Pointer School, Heath House Preparatory School, Blackheath High Junior School, Blackheath High Seniors School, Colfes and Eltham College.
Other amenities such as the Cinema, Ikea and other large stores can be found at Greenwich Peninsula which is a 4 minutes’ drive.

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on September 29, 2022
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2
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on September 29, 2022
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
